Output 4da6000331e4e79a541635c110cd3f8fb52853ab07169eeacb4e9737ecd7996e:0

value
27232671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5ecd6986550d49e9323394bd18d8c0f4b16128 OP_EQUAL
address
3LKdLfPtdp5mhUeYhVVZX5nCBh84SaQg2B
transaction
4da6000331e4e79a541635c110cd3f8fb52853ab07169eeacb4e9737ecd7996e
confirmations
275129
spent
true